## Ownership

Heads up, release managers: this repo holds the read-replica lag alarm for the Tidewell cluster. If lag crosses the threshold during a deploy, the alarm pages and you should pause the rollout — no exceptions. Threshold tweaks are fine, but they need a quick review first since a too-quiet alarm once cost us a messy Friday. For threshold changes or silencing requests, the person to ping is named below.

named custodian: Belius Casath Ulaix Sorius

Hey, welcome aboard! Quick heads-up: the Glimmerbase CI occasionally fails on the calendar-sync integration tests because two fixture events overlap in the Tidewell staging tenant. It's not your code — just re-run the `calsync` stage after clearing the fixture cache. If it still fails, ping anyone on the Orbit team. The offending build token is below.

build token for tawip-yageg: htk9_92ac43d42

Subject: Q3 Cash-Flow Forecast — Branch Managers

Hi all,

The Q3 forecast is now in the shared workspace, and it's a mixed bag. Collections improved across the Northvale and Summerden branches, but the Orlen Park refurbishment is eating more cash than planned. We're asking each branch to trim discretionary spend by roughly five percent and tighten invoice follow-up to under thirty days. Nothing alarming, just prudence while margins are thin. There's one strategic item you should be aware of, noted confidentially below.

board note of bawep-tajef: Queniusek Systems plans to raise the Quenvan list price by 53.1 percent in March. The pricing group signed off on a budget of $176.4 million for Project Drueth. The renewal with Casionix Partners closes at $142.5 million a year, 8.3 percent below the last contract. Project Fraax slips by six weeks because of the tooling delay.